Warning Signs You Need Flooded Basement Cleanup

Catching the signs of basement water issues early can save you a lot of time, money, and headaches. Ignoring them often leads to more extensive damage and costly repairs. Pay attention to what your basement is telling you. Early detection is crucial for preventing major problems. Recognizing these signs means you can take proactive steps before it’s too late.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

A persistent, damp, or musty smell in your basement is a strong indicator of hidden moisture and potential mold growth. This odor often signals that water has been present long enough to cause problems. Addressing odors quickly is a sign of a healthy home. Don’t let lingering smells persist.

Visible Water Stains or Dampness

Look for water marks on walls, ceilings, or floors. Even if the area feels dry to the touch, stains mean water has been there and could be causing damage behind the surface. Investigating water stains is important. These can indicate ongoing moisture issues.

Peeling or Bubbling Paint and Drywall

Water seeping into building materials can cause paint to blister and drywall to deteriorate. This is a clear sign that moisture is compromising the integrity of your walls. Damaged paint is a visual cue. Bubbling indicates water intrusion.

Warped Baseboards or Flooring

Wood products are particularly susceptible to water damage. If you notice baseboards pulling away from the wall or flooring buckling, it’s a sign of moisture absorption. Warped materials need attention. This is a clear sign of water saturation.

Efflorescence on Concrete Walls

This is a white, powdery substance that appears on concrete surfaces. It’s a sign that water is moving through the concrete, carrying minerals with it. Recognizing efflorescence means you have a water problem. It points to persistent moisture.

Increased Humidity Levels

If your basement consistently feels damp or clammy, even with ventilation, it suggests an underlying moisture issue that needs professional attention. High humidity can lead to discomfort. It signals potential unseen water damage.

Flooded Basement Cleanup v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
A few inches of clean water from a minor pipe leak. Yes, with caution. Maybe. If you have the right equipment and can dry it completely within 24-48 hours.
Significant standing water (more than a foot). No. Yes. DIY equipment can’t handle the volume, and professional extraction is crucial.
Water from a sewage backup or contaminated source. Absolutely Not. Yes. This is a serious health hazard requiring specialized containment and sanitation.
Water has been sitting for over 48 hours. No. Yes. Mold and bacteria growth are highly likely, requiring professional remediation.
Water has soaked into insulation, carpets, or drywall. No. Yes. These materials hold moisture and require professional drying and potential removal.
You’re unsure of the water source or extent of damage. No. Yes. A professional assessment is needed to identify the cause and scope of the problem.

While minor water issues might seem manageable, a truly flooded basement often requires professional intervention. The risks of mold, structural damage, and incomplete drying are too high to leave to chance. When in doubt, it’s always best to call in the experts for a thorough assessment and effective cleanup. Flooded Basement Cleanup Cost In Northlake, TX

The cost of flooded basement cleanup in Northlake, TX can vary widely. Factors like the amount of water, the size of your basement, the type of materials affected, and how quickly we can access the property all play a role. These figures are general estimates to give you an idea. Understanding costs upfront helps. We provide detailed estimates after an inspection.

Service Aspect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water Extraction (up to 1000 sq ft) $500 – $2,500 Volume of water, accessibility.
Structural Drying (equipment rental and setup) $750 – $3,000+ Size of basement, duration of drying needed.
Dehumidification and Air Movers Included in Drying Package Number of units required.
Mold Prevention Treatment $300 – $1,000+ Area treated, type of solution used.
Odor Removal $400 – $1,500+ Severity of odor, treatment methods.
Minor Rebuilding (e.g., drywall repair) $500 – $2,000+ Scope of repairs needed.

Common Questions About Flooded Basement Cleanup

How long does flooded basement cleanup take?

The timeline for flooded basement cleanup varies greatly. Initial water extraction might take a few hours to a day. However, the crucial structural drying process, using air movers and dehumidifiers, can take anywhere from 3 to 10 days, sometimes longer, depending on how saturated your home became. We work diligently to speed up the process safely. Faster drying prevents secondary damage. Our goal is to get your basement fully restored quickly.

Is flooded basement cleanup covered by insurance?

In most cases, water damage from sudden events like burst pipes or heavy storms is covered by homeowner’s insurance. However, damage from slow leaks or lack of maintenance often isn’t. We can help you navigate the insurance process, providing documentation and working with your adjuster to ensure your claim is handled properly. Insurance claims assistance is a key service. We help you document the damage.

What are the health risks of a flooded basement?

A flooded basement can pose significant health risks due to potential mold growth and bacteria from contaminated water. Mold can cause respiratory problems, allergies, and other health issues. Bacteria from sewage or standing water can lead to infections. It’s vital to address flooded basements quickly and thoroughly to prevent these hazards. Protecting your family’s health is paramount. Can I prevent my basement from flooding again?

Preventing future flooding involves several steps. Ensure your gutters and downspouts are clear and direct water away from your foundation. Check for cracks in your foundation and seal them. Consider installing a sump pump if you’re in a high-water table area. Regular maintenance of plumbing can also prevent bursts. We can offer advice on preventative measures.
